Our Commitment to Sustainability

Sustainability and Sourcing

  • Our brands have extensive documentation and manufacturing commitments to sustainable materials.
  • Our brands are not associated with The Red List. The “Red List of Threatened Species” is a specific and well-known conservation database maintained by the International Union for Conservation of Nature (IUCN).
  • Our brands commit to sourcing materials from responsibly managed forests and suppliers that adhere to sustainable harvesting practices.
  • Prioritize the use of certified sustainable wood, recycled materials, and low-impact production processes.

Eco-Friendly Manufacturing

  • Invest in energy-efficient manufacturing processes and facilities to reduce carbon emissions.
  • Implement waste reduction and recycling programs within production facilities.
  • Explore alternative materials and technologies that have a lower environmental footprint.

Transparency and Certifications

  • Our brands are happy to provide information and full transparency about the materials used in furniture production, including certifications like FSC (Forest Stewardship Council) for wood sourcing and Green Guard for low emissions. Energy Efficiency and Packaging

  • Optimize transportation logistics to reduce energy consumption and emissions.
  • Use minimal and recyclable packaging materials, reducing waste and environmental impact.

Reducing Chemicals and Toxins

  • Commit to using low-VOC (volatile organic compounds) finishes and adhesives to improve indoor air quality.
  • Avoid harmful chemicals and toxins in furniture production.

Sustainable Supply Chain Practices

  • Collaborate with suppliers and partners who share a commitment to sustainability.
  • Ensure fair labor practices and ethical treatment of workers throughout the supply chain.

Energy and Resource Conservation

  • Implement energy-efficient lighting and HVAC systems in retail stores and manufacturing facilities.
  • Monitor and reduce water consumption in production processes.
